About Dr. Miller

John-Mark M. Miller, DO practices family medicine in Clinton, NC. John-Mark is a 2002 graduate of Philadelphia College of Osteopathic Medicine. Medicare claims data shows John-Mark provided 389 services to 254 patients. The services billed most often include established patient office or other outpatient visit with moderate level of decision making, if using time, 30 minutes or more, insertion of needle into vein for collection of blood sample, and established patient office or other outpatient visit with low level od decision making, if using time, 20 minutes or more.
